Physical Description |
|
First edition. 15x21cm. 672 pages. Slight tears to dust jacket. Otherwise in good condition. Powerful dust jacket illustration by renowned American artist Rockwell Kent. |
| |
|
|
Detailed Description |
|
Most famous American Jewish espionage trial of the mid 20th century, which culminated in the electric chair execution of a couple who many, till this day, believe were innocent victims of the Cold War politics of the 1950's |
